Lakeeta Hill joined Cargill’s law department in 2014, leading the board operations team. Over the past four years, Ms. Hill has directed large, cross-functional regional and global projects of key strategic initiatives and led transformational organizational-wide processes. As the current assistant vice president, global legal operations, she drives transformation and efficiency gains by partnering with a talented team of global legal professionals.
For more than 10 years, Ms. Hill has served as a strategic thought leader, advisor and partner to senior leaders, holding different positions in the areas of class action administration, corporate governance and corporate and healthcare law. Prior to joining Cargill, Ms. Hill worked for American Family Insurance in the office of the corporate secretary, where she was actively engaged in aligning corporate governance with AmFam’s growth, development and restructuring initiatives.
Originally from Milwaukee, Wisconsin, Ms. Hill holds a Master of Business Administration with an emphasis in accounting and a specialization in health care, and an undergraduate degree in criminal justice administration. Her commitment to service includes membership and leadership posts in the Society for Corporate Governance (leader, conference panelist); the Private Companies Committee (subcommittee chair); and Cargill’s Ebony Council (vice chair, advisory board member).
Ms. Hill is married to Jermaine Hill and they have three children.
